Preheat over to 350. Cut bread in criss-cross pattern (not all the way through). Stuff cheese slices into the bread. Rinse chopped onion and dry. Mix melted butter, onions and poppy seed. Place bread on enough foil to enclose the loaf. Pour butter mixture over the bread. Wrap foil leaving small opening at the top. Bake for 20 minutes.
